Transaction 104167e2deb70d83894313333b61ba6128ef483313edfea4658bc056524a4e65

1 Input
2 Outputs
  • 104167e2deb70d83894313333b61ba6128ef483313edfea4658bc056524a4e65:0
  • value  400576
    address  bc1q8aewefy2fahvzfgkyslcvvmazmdng8lragqm58
  • 104167e2deb70d83894313333b61ba6128ef483313edfea4658bc056524a4e65:1
  • value  4246108
    address  3LDfNwA7o4xfHsWgjZYzKn9zCNePv4Et8F